Overview

Vermont imposes a 14% excise tax on recreational cannabis sales, plus the standard 6% state sales tax. Municipalities may levy an additional 1% local option tax, bringing the maximum rate to 21%. Medical cannabis patients are exempt from all cannabis-specific taxes. Vermont's retail market launched in 2022 and revenue is still growing as the licensing system matures. Revenue is allocated to the general fund, substance abuse prevention, and after-school programs.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the total cannabis tax in Vermont?+
Up to 21%: 14% excise + 6% sales + 1% local option. Most areas see about 20% total.
Is medical cannabis taxed in Vermont?+
No. Medical cannabis patients registered with the state are exempt from all cannabis taxes.
When did Vermont start selling recreational cannabis?+
Vermont legalized cannabis in 2018 but retail sales did not begin until October 2022. Revenue is still ramping up.
